Getting a Handle on My Eating Habits

December 27, 2007 by Kristen King  
Filed under Women's Health

I’ve been thinking a lot lately about my eating issues, and I’ve decided that it is really time to start doing something about it. So today was the third day in a row that I ate breakfast, lunch, and dinner. Three days, three meals each. It feels weird. I feel strangely full, and my head hurts (which is probably a coincidence, but stil odd).

Figuring out portions is challenging, expecially since I’m eating so frequently that I’m not starving when I sit down, so I keep taking too much and having to put it back, push it off on someone else, or throw it out. But I’m eating. And I’m proud of myself, because it’s harder than one might think! But weird as it is, it also feels good. It feels normal despite the absolute strangeness of it. Let’s see how long I can keep it going…
